Google is experimenting with even more ad types. The newest announcement involves a whole new type of interactive ads called Google Gadget Ads. Google has already been testing the ads, and the company and observers are quite impressed with the technical capacity of the ads, even going so far as to call them a breakthrough.

Gadget Ads is very far reaching,” said Andrew Frank, an online advertising analyst with market research firm Gartner Inc. “This is the platform that Google is going to build all their cross-media advertising services upon,” he said.

The new advertising service is designed for broad adoption across Google sites, including iGoogle personalized home pages that tens of millions of consumers use for searching and to be notified of updated information on the Web at large. The new format works across Google’s network of hundreds of thousands of affiliated sites and can be embedded in YouTube videos.

The ads use Flash and AJAX and represent a major step forward because they offer interactivity in a sense that is not currently being delivered.
